Search Engine for Electronic Components containing over 350 Million Unique Part Numbers from the World's Top Component Manufacturers

Liquid & Level Controllers by Crouzet Automation

63 match, viewing page 2 of 2

Part# 84870503

Part# 84870700

Part# 84870502

Part# 84870501

Part# 84870308

Part# 84870309

Part# 84870306

Part# 84870303

Part# 84870304

Part# 84870211

Part# 84870301

Part# 84870504

Part# 84870403

11-May-2024 10:46:02